Overall Meaning

In the song "Drunken Barrelhouse Blues" by Memphis Minnie, the lyrics convey a sense of honesty and openness as the singer promises to reveal the truth to the listeners. The singer sets the tone by stating that they will explain what is happening, emphasizing the presence of something desirable that is abundant and overflowing. This introduction suggests a candid and straightforward approach to storytelling.


The lyrics then shift to the singer acknowledging their state of inebriation, expressing a lack of concern for judgment or criticism. Despite being drunk in the morning, the singer asserts that they have knowledge to share but will not disclose anything hurtful. This juxtaposition of being intoxicated yet willing to impart wisdom highlights a sense of defiance and self-assurance in the singer's character.


As the song progresses, the singer contemplates the idea of causing destruction while intoxicated, suggesting a rebellious and chaotic energy within them. The mention of tearing down the barrelhouse due to financial constraints but the ability to leave town without consequence showcases a mix of desperation and freedom in the singer's mindset. This act of defiance reflects a desire to escape limitations and embrace a transient lifestyle.


The lyrics then touch upon the singer's desire for continued intoxication, expressing a preference for alcohol to maintain a state of inebriation. Whether it is requesting a specific type of drink or acknowledging the sobering effects of sobriety, the singer's yearning for intoxication reveals a longing for escape and release. This longing for drunkenness serves as a recurring theme throughout the song, portraying a complex and multifaceted depiction of the singer's mindset and emotions.
